Celltrionについて

Celltrion is a biopharmaceutical company best known for biosimilars, near-copies of complex biologic drugs whose patents have expired. It developed one of the world's first approved antibody biosimilars and has built a portfolio spanning treatments for autoimmune diseases, cancer, and other conditions, sold in the United States, Europe, and other markets. Following the absorption of its distribution affiliate Celltrion Healthcare, the company handles both development, manufacturing at its Incheon plants, and overseas sales within a single listed entity. It is also pushing into novel-drug research and subcutaneous reformulations of existing products to extend franchise life.

Unlike most large Korean issuers, Celltrion is founder-led rather than part of a traditional chaebol, so governance debate has centered on transactions among affiliated companies and the long-mooted consolidation of the wider group structure. Revenue is overwhelmingly generated abroad, tying results to drug-pricing dynamics and reimbursement rules in the United States and Europe. Each product faces a defined competitive window as rival biosimilars launch, making pipeline replenishment a structural necessity. The stock carries a large weight in Korean health-care benchmarks, tends to trade on clinical and regulatory milestones, and has historically attracted heavy domestic retail participation.

Celltrion was founded in 2002 by entrepreneur Seo Jung-jin, a former Daewoo executive who bet on biologics manufacturing in Incheon before biosimilars were an established industry. The company initially made drugs under contract for multinationals, then pivoted to developing its own biosimilars, gaining European approval for a pioneering antibody biosimilar in 2013. For years the group operated through a split structure, with Celltrion manufacturing products and separately listed Celltrion Healthcare selling them abroad, an arrangement long criticized for opacity; the two merged at the end of 2023, uniting production and distribution. A third affiliate handles chemical drugs in the domestic market.

Revenue flows from selling finished biosimilars to hospital systems, pharmacy chains, and wholesalers in Europe, the United States, and other markets, increasingly through the company's own direct-sales subsidiaries rather than third-party partners, a shift that captures distribution margin. Winning tenders and formulary placements is the core commercial mechanic, since biosimilars compete chiefly on price and reliability of supply against both originator drugs and rival copies. In-house manufacturing at scale underpins cost competitiveness, and newer differentiated products, such as subcutaneous reformulations with regulatory exclusivities, earn better pricing than plain copies. Export markets supply the great bulk of sales, making reimbursement policy abroad the key external variable.

よくある質問

What does Celltrion do?

Celltrion is a South Korean biopharmaceutical company that develops and manufactures biosimilars, near-copies of complex biologic drugs whose patents have expired, treating autoimmune diseases, cancers, and other conditions. It produces at large plants in Incheon and sells worldwide, while also developing novel drugs and improved formulations of existing products.

Who controls Celltrion?

Founder Seo Jung-jin controls the company through Celltrion Holdings, the family holding vehicle that is the largest shareholder. Unlike most major Korean issuers, Celltrion is not part of a traditional conglomerate; beyond the founder's stake, ownership is spread across institutions and an unusually large domestic retail shareholder base.

How can foreign investors get exposure to Celltrion?

Celltrion trades on the Korea Exchange under ticker 068270 and carries a heavy weight in Korean health-care indexes. It has no overseas depositary receipts, so access is typically through brokers offering Korean market trading or through Korea-focused and biotech-oriented ETFs that hold the Seoul-listed shares.
